About the Role

At SCA Health, we are committed to building a high-performing, purpose-driven culture where teammates feel connected, included, and empowered to do their best work. We are seeking a dynamic and strategic Director, Culture, Engagement & Inclusion to lead our enterprise approach to organizational culture, employee engagement, inclusion, and the overall teammate experience. This role will help bring our OneTeam culture to life across the organization and strengthen organizational health through data-driven insights, scalable programs, and meaningful partnerships with leaders.

Reporting to the Senior Director, Organizational Effectiveness, the Director, Culture, Engagement & Inclusion will serve as the enterprise leader responsible for culture strategy, employee engagement, inclusion, organizational health, and enterprise listening initiatives. This role partners closely with executive leaders, HR Business Partners, Talent Management, Leadership Development, Internal Communications, and business leaders to create a workplace experience that drives performance, retention, collaboration, and inclusion. This role supports culture, engagement, and inclusion strategies impacting approximately 20,000 teammates across the organization.
